Google Cloud Security Blog · tool

Now in preview: Find and fix software vulnerabilities with CodeMender

Google opened a preview of CodeMender, an AI code-security agent delivered through Gemini Enterprise Agent Platform and AI Threat Defense. It is designed to inspect code, identify and validate potentially exploitable defects, and produce targeted fixes, with Google’s specialized Gemini 3.5 Flash Cyber model initially restricted to governments and trusted partners.

Anthropic · framework

Anthropic Responsible Scaling Policy v3.2

Anthropic’s current Responsible Scaling Policy page lists v3.2 as effective April 29, 2026, adding formal authority for external review of risk reports and regular briefings to its Long-Term Benefit Trust.

OpenAI News · analysis

OpenAI and Hugging Face partner to address security incident during model evaluation

During an internal cyber evaluation, OpenAI models with reduced refusal safeguards escaped a constrained research environment by exploiting a zero-day in a package-cache proxy. The agents then escalated privileges, reached the public internet, and chained additional flaws and stolen credentials into Hugging Face production systems while pursuing benchmark answers.
